Naija

Etymology

From English: jolly

Pronunciation

  • dʒɔ̀lídʒɔ̀lí

Play

Definition

Adjective

  • Wetin person dey do make e mind dey sweet am
  • Ikemefuna come Umuofia for the end of di jollyjolly season between harvest and planting.  — (katakata__237, Ikemefuna came to Umuofia at the end of the celebration of harvest and planting seasons.)

Synonyms

flenjo


Translations

  • English: celebration

Verb

Make person do wetin dey make im mind dey totori am.

  • Dem dey jollyjolly sey dem win match.  — (NSC_Ajede_2020, They are celebrating because they won a match__)
  • Dem go arrange am for disable pikin to get correct chance to go school, treatment for hospital, proper place to settle am, and to jollyjolly.  — They will make plans for the disabled child to have access to education, healthcare, accommodation and entertainment.)

Synonyms

Translations

  • English: celebrate, enjoy
